i have a 98 civic ex auto. i bought with a seized engine with the plan to take what i needed from it for my car then part out the rest. but now i don't have the time or the ambition to deal with selling it piece by piece, i would much rather get it running and make it a sweet ride to sell whole. where i need help is i would like to fix it as cheap as posible and was looking to go the used motor from a junk yard. is there an easier/cheaper way?
 
no d series motor is one of the cheapest out there. i think u can get a whole swap for 600-750. how many miles on it. if it has alot u might as well do a whole swap otherwise just buy the long block and swap it.
 
the car has about 167000 on it. im just looking to get it running to sell. how intense is just the long block?
 
Take the spark plugs out, and poor a little oil into each cylinder. Let it sit for a few hours or so, and then give it a try.. try starting it.

u can prolly get it from a guy in these forums who is swappin his out for around 200, mayby a bit more. but if u go to an online store or something like that they might rip you off. i seen them on hmotorsports online for 650 for the whole thing. havnt ever seen a long block for sale tho. if i had the cash to swap out my d16 for a b18c id sell u mine for 150. but i don't so sorry. just look around the marketplace in these forums im sure someone has one.
 
jason is right. if u dont give two shits about the motor inthere put a little dab of oil. mabe a tsp or so in each let it sit over night and try startin it. but if it doesn't work it will mess the motor up more
 
Pour marvel mystery oil in the spark plugs. I know several people who have saved many seized engines with that.

It shouldn't mess it up more, it will burn the oil and your motor will smoke heavily until it burns it all up. After its all burned up, and IF the motor is saved, change out the plugs asap.
